Alia Bhatt reacts to ‘Pathaan’ breaking ‘Brahmastra's BO record; Varun Dhawan reacts to boycott calls

Actors Alia Bhatt and Varun Dhawan were seen together at the Zee Cine awards 2023 press conference on Tuesday evening. The duo reacted to the box office success of ‘Pathaan’ at the event and called the film 'possibly the biggest blockbuster of Indian cinema'.

When asked about whether she sees the success of ‘Pathaan’, ‘Gangubai Kathiawadi’, and ‘Brahmastra’ as an answer to the negativity, Alia said, ‘I don’t think we have so much aggression in us like that. We are very grateful to be working and living our dream on a day-to-day basis. And we believe that we belong to the audience and the audience can say whatever they want about us. As long as we are entertaining them we will do our very best.’

Speaking about ‘Pathaan’, she said, ‘We feel very very happy as an industry that a film like Pathaan is not just a blockbuster but possibly the biggest blockbuster of Indian cinema. I think everybody should definitely clap for that once. We feel grateful for moments like this and pray that yahi hota rahe (this should continue happening).’

When a reporter mentioned that ‘Pathaan’ broke ‘Brahmastra's record, Alia added, ‘Every film should break every film's record. I am very happy with that.’
Varun also reacted to ‘Pathaan’s box office numbers and said one must not pay heed to boycott trends as the film’s success is a testament that the audience is only looking for pure entertainment.

He said, ‘I don't want to talk about it. Why should we give so much importance to it? If people are liking it (Pathaan), then be happy. We should not discuss much about it. The collections are speaking about the reach of Indian cinema, of Hindi cinema. And when you have some of the biggest stars of this country in Pathaan, be it Shah Rukh sir, Salman bhai, Deepika Padukone and John, you are giving the audience what they want and that's entertainment.’

‘Pathaan’, which marks Shah Rukh Khan’s comeback to the big screen after four years, has collected Rs 296 crore at the box office and has breached the Rs 500 crore mark overseas.
